There are 10 ways to get from Chicago Midway Airport (MDW) to Greyhound Bus Terminal by subway, plane, bus, train, bus (Greyhound), taxi, bus (Flixbus), rideshare, or car
Select an option below to see step-by-step directions and to compare ticket prices and travel times in Rome2Rio's travel planner.
Subway to Chicago O'Hare International Airport, fly to Evansville
best- Take the subway from Midway to Clark/Lake
- Fly from Chicago O'Hare International Airport (ORD) to Evansville (EVV)ORD - EVV
3h 49m$66–305Drive 287.6 mi
cheapest- Drive from Chicago Midway Airport (MDW) to Greyhound Bus Terminal287.6 mi
5h 59m$53–76Fly Chicago Midway International Airport to Louisville International Airport, bus
- Fly from Chicago Midway International Airport (MDW) to Louisville International Airport (SDF)MDW - SDF
- Take the bus from Louisville, KY to Evansville, IN
6h 21m$105–496Train, bus
- Take the train from Summit Amtrak to St. LouisLincoln Service / ...
- Take the bus from St Louis Bus Station to Evansville Bus StationGreyhound US0185
10h 47m$61–162Bus
- Take the bus from Chicago Bus Station to Indianapolis Union StationGreyhound US0100 / ...
- Take the bus from Indianapolis Union Station to Evansville, INIndianapolis
10h 57m$95–175Fly Chicago O'Hare International Airport to Owensboro–Daviess County Regional Airport, taxi
- Fly from Chicago O'Hare International Airport (ORD) to Owensboro–Daviess County Regional Airport (OWB)ORD - OWB
- Take the taxi from Owensboro–Daviess County Regional Airport (OWB) to Greyhound Bus Terminal
4h 32m$140–280Train, bus via LaSalle/Van Buren
- Take the train from Chicago Union Station to St. LouisLincoln Service / ...
- Take the bus from St Louis Bus Station to Evansville Bus StationGreyhound US0185
11h 3m$72–375Bus via Bloomington
- Take the bus from Chicago to BloomingtonFlixBus 2515 / ...
- Take the bus from Bloomington, IN to Evansville, INIndianapolis
11h 27m$71–157Train, bus #2
- Take the train from Chicago Union Station to IndianapolisCardinal
- Take the bus from Indianapolis Union Station to Evansville, INIndianapolis
12h 11m$88–155Airport Transfer
- Take the rideshare from Chicago Midway-MDW to Greyhound Bus Terminal287.6 mi
5h 59m
Chicago Midway Airport (MDW) to Greyhound Bus Terminal by bus, foot, and train
Questions & Answers
The cheapest way to get from Chicago Midway Airport (MDW) to Greyhound Bus Terminal is to drive which costs $50 - $80 and takes 5h 59m.
The fastest way to get from Chicago Midway Airport (MDW) to Greyhound Bus Terminal is to subway and fly which takes 3h 49m and costs $65 - $310.
No, there is no direct bus from Chicago Midway Airport (MDW) station to Greyhound Bus Terminal. However, there are services departing from Midway Orange Line Station and arriving at Evansville, IN via Cicero & 24th Place Terminal, Chicago Bus Station and Indianapolis Union Station. The journey, including transfers, takes approximately 10h 57m.
The distance between Chicago Midway Airport (MDW) and Greyhound Bus Terminal is 311 miles. The road distance is 289.2 miles.
The best way to get from Chicago Midway Airport (MDW) to Greyhound Bus Terminal without a car is to train and bus which takes 10h 47m and costs $60 - $170.
It takes approximately 3h 49m to get from Chicago Midway Airport (MDW) to Greyhound Bus Terminal, including transfers.
Chicago Midway Airport (MDW) to Greyhound Bus Terminal bus services, operated by Greyhound USA, depart from Chicago Bus Station.
Chicago Midway Airport (MDW) to Greyhound Bus Terminal bus services, operated by Greyhound USA, arrive at Indianapolis Union Station.
Yes, the driving distance between Chicago Midway Airport (MDW) to Greyhound Bus Terminal is 289 miles. It takes approximately 5h 59m to drive from Chicago Midway Airport (MDW) to Greyhound Bus Terminal.
There are 87+ hotels available in Greyhound Bus Terminal.
What companies run services between Chicago Midway Airport (MDW), USA and Greyhound Bus Terminal, IN, USA?
You can take a bus from Midway Orange Line Station to Greyhound Bus Terminal via Cicero & 24th Place, Cicero & 24th Place Terminal, Jefferson & Harrison, Chicago Bus Station, Indianapolis Union Station, and Evansville, IN in around 10h 57m.
- Website
- southwest.com
Flights from Chicago Midway International Airport to Louisville International Airport
- Ave. Duration
- 1h 14m
- When
- Every day
- Estimated price
- $65–440
- Website
- aa.com
Flights from Chicago O'Hare International Airport to Evansville
- Ave. Duration
- 1h 19m
- When
- Every day
- Estimated price
- $40–270
- Website
- contouraviation.com
Flights from Chicago O'Hare International Airport to Owensboro–Daviess County Regional Airport
- Ave. Duration
- 1h 30m
- When
- Every day
- Estimated price
- $55–170
- Phone
- +1 888-968-7282
- Website
- transitchicago.com
Subway from Midway to Clark/Lake
- Ave. Duration
- 31 min
- Frequency
- Every 15 minutes
- Estimated price
- $2–5
- Website
- https://www.transitchicago.com
- Schedules at
- https://www.transitchicago.com/schedules/
- Adult
- $2–5
Rome2Rio's guide to Amtrak
Contact Details
- Phone
- +1 800-872-7245
- Website
- amtrak.com
Train from Summit Amtrak to St. Louis
- Ave. Duration
- 4h 37m
- Frequency
- 3 times a day
- Estimated price
- $29–110
- Website
- https://www.amtrak.com/home.html
Train from Chicago Union Station to St. Louis
- Ave. Duration
- 4h 46m
- Frequency
- 5 times a day
- Estimated price
- $40–320
- Website
- https://www.amtrak.com/home.html
Train from Chicago Union Station to Indianapolis
- Ave. Duration
- 4h 54m
- Frequency
- 3 times a week
- Estimated price
- $30–75
- Website
- https://www.amtrak.com/home.html
- Phone
- +1 502-368-5644 x 135
- Website
- ridewithmiller.com
Bus from Louisville, KY to Evansville, IN
- Ave. Duration
- 2h 20m
- Frequency
- Once daily
- Estimated price
- $35–55
- Website
- https://ridewithmiller.com
Bus from Indianapolis Union Station to Evansville, IN
- Ave. Duration
- 4h 35m
- Frequency
- Once daily
- Estimated price
- $55–75
- Website
- https://ridewithmiller.com
Bus from Bloomington, IN to Evansville, IN
- Ave. Duration
- 3h 25m
- Frequency
- Once daily
- Estimated price
- $40–60
- Website
- https://ridewithmiller.com
Rome2Rio's guide to Greyhound USA
Contact Details
- Phone
- +1 214-849-8100
- ifsr@greyhound.com
- Website
- greyhound.com
Bus from St Louis Bus Station to Evansville Bus Station
- Ave. Duration
- 3h 35m
- Frequency
- Once daily
- Estimated price
- $30–50
- Website
- https://www.greyhound.com/
Bus from Chicago Bus Station to Indianapolis Union Station
- Ave. Duration
- 3h 5m
- Frequency
- Every 4 hours
- Estimated price
- $35–95
- Website
- https://www.greyhound.com/
- Phone
- +1 (855) 626-8585
- Website
- flixbus.com
Bus from Chicago to Bloomington
- Ave. Duration
- 4h 55m
- Frequency
- Twice daily
- Estimated price
- $27–90
- Schedules at
- flixbus.com
- Adult
- $27–90
- Website
- mozio.com
Rideshare from Chicago Midway-MDW to Greyhound Bus Terminal
- Ave. Duration
- 5h 59m
- Frequency
- On demand
Want to know more about travelling around United States
Rome2Rio's Travel Guide series provide vital information for the global traveller. Filled with useful and timely travel information, the guides answer all the hard questions - such as 'How do I buy a ticket?', 'Should I book online before I travel? ', 'How much should I expect to pay?', 'Do the trains and buses have Wifi?' - to help you get the most out of your next trip.
Related travel guides
Travelling to the US: What do I need to know?
Read the travel guide
Why you should take the train in the US
Read the travel guide
Need to know: Greyhound
Read the travel guide
More Questions & Answers
Check out Blablacar's carpooling service for rideshare options between Chicago Midway Airport (MDW) and Greyhound Bus Terminal. A great option if you don't have a driver's licence or want to avoid public transport.
















